作为一名程序员,在开发过程中,难免会遇到各种各样的问题。其中,JSP调用JS时出现的乱码问题,相信让不少人都头疼不已。今天,我就来给大家分享一个关于JSP调用JS乱码实例的解决方法,希望能帮助到大家。

一、问题分析

在JSP页面中调用JavaScript时,如果遇到乱码问题,通常有以下几种情况:

JSP调用JS乱码实例解决跨文件编码问题全攻略  第1张

1. HTML页面编码与JavaScript文件编码不一致:这是最常见的原因。例如,HTML页面使用UTF-8编码,而JavaScript文件使用GBK编码。

2. JavaScript文件在服务器上保存时,编码被改变:在保存JavaScript文件时,如果使用了一些特殊字符,可能会被自动转换为其他编码。

3. 浏览器解析乱码:当HTML页面和JavaScript文件编码不一致时,浏览器在解析过程中可能会出现乱码。

二、解决方案

1. 确保HTML页面和JavaScript文件编码一致

我们需要确保HTML页面和JavaScript文件的编码一致。以下是一个简单的例子:

文件名编码
index.jspUTF-8
script.jsUTF-8

在HTML页面中,我们需要声明编码类型:

```html

本文由 @失声痛哭 发布在 泰然曲谱网 ,如有疑问,请联系我们。
文章链接:http://trqpw.cn/QfXrOY_OarCNWrYqfTEBT